  • today, I thought I'd share with you the Japanese macaroni salad recipe.

  • I used to make this a lot because I love Japanese mayo.

  • Japanese mayo is a lot different from American mayonnaise, So I highly suggest using Japanese mayo for this recipe because it's such a different taste.

  • Um, you can find it at any Asian store I'm not sure of.

  • Regular grocery stores will have it.

  • You can look up online what was substitute for a Japanese mayo.

  • But if you confined Japanese mayo, that'll be the best option for this recipe.

  • Um, other than that, everything else is super easy to find.

  • You'll need soy sauce on the, uh, some elbow macaroni noodles, corn, cucumbers, forgot onion and from him.

  • So it's super duper easy to make on.
